Lazio are reportedly considering a move for Borussia Monchengladbach centre-back Fabio Chiarodia.

Fabio Chiarodia’s Background

The 21-year-old was born and raised in Oldenburg, Germany. He began his career at the hometown club before moving to Werder Bremen’s academy, and climbed his way up the ranks to become a member of the first team. In 2023, the defender completed his transfer to Gladbach on a deal worth €1 million.

Senior Italia Debut

On the international stage, Chiarodia had represented Germany at the U15 before declaring for his country of origin, Italy. After playing with the Azzurrini at various youth levels, the defender earned his senior debut earlier this week in the 1-0 victory over Luxembourg. Interim manager Silvio Baldini opted to give youngsters the chance to prove their worth, and Chiarodia was in the starting lineup.

Lazio Add Chiarodia to Post-Alessio Romagnoli Shortlist

According to Il Messaggero, Lazio have identified the Monchengladbach youngster as one of their options to replace Alessio Romagnoli, who is expected to finalize his transfer to Al-Sadd in the coming days. The alternative option remains Brighton’s wantaway Diego Coppola.

Why Lazio Are Encouraged to Pursue Chiarodia

Chiarodia’s contract with the Bundesliga side will expire in June 2027, so he could be available at a discount this summer. Transfermarkt estimates his current value at €3 million. It should also be noted that, thanks to a newly implemented regulation, the costs of signing Italian players under the age of 23 are exempt from the financial statements that Serie A clubs present to the supervisory committee.
